SALT LAKE CITY — A teenage boy is dead after crashing his motorcycle on the Alpine Loop Monday afternoon.
Lt. Cam Roden with the Utah Highway Patrol said a 17-year-old boy was riding a motorcycle down the Alpine Loop toward American Fork on state Route 92 near the Timpanogos Cave National Monument.
The Department of Public Safety said the teen lost control after rounding a corner. The 17-year-old crashed and sustained serious injuries.
Following this, via ambulance, the 17-year-old was transported further down the canyon, where he was meant to be airlifted in a helicopter to the hospital. However, Roden said the teen died before making it to the helicopter.
The American Fork side of the Alpine Loop is currently closed.
